Ques. What is Computer Science and Business Systems and how is it different from regular Computer Science?
Ans. Computer Science and Business Systems is a specialized program that combines computer science with enterprise business systems management. While regular Computer Science focuses on algorithms, software development, and computational theory, Computer Science and Business Systems emphasizes ERP systems, business intelligence, IT service management, and enterprise solutions. This program is ideal for students interested in IT service management roles, enterprise systems implementation, and business technology consulting.

Ques. Is there an entrance exam for B.Tech Lateral Entry in Computer Science and Business Systems?
Ans. No, there is no entrance examination for B.Tech Lateral Entry admissions at JAIN (Deemed-to-be University). Admission is purely merit-based, determined by your diploma percentage and the availability of seats in the program. This makes the admission process more straightforward and faster compared to regular B.Tech admissions which require the JET entrance test.
Ques. What is the total cost of the B.Tech Lateral Entry program in Computer Science and Business Systems?
Ans. The total tuition cost for the 3-year B.Tech Lateral Entry program is INR 10,50,000 (INR 3,50,000 per annum x 3 years), plus a one-time registration fee of INR 30,000. Hostel accommodation is optional and costs between INR 1,80,000 to INR 2,20,000 per annum depending on the room type. EMI options are available through Liqui Loans for flexible fee payment.
Ques. What diploma qualifications are required for admission to B.Tech Lateral Entry in Computer Science and Business Systems?
Ans. Candidates must hold a diploma in Computer Science and Engineering, Information Science and Engineering, Electronics and Communication Engineering, or Electronics and Instrumentation Engineering. The minimum requirement is 45% marks (40% for SC/ST/Backward Classes) in the final year diploma examination, though candidates must achieve 60% to complete the admission process after receiving a provisional offer letter. There is no entrance examination required for lateral entry admissions.
